The Disciplinary Action Form Printable for Insubordination is a formal document utilized to address and record instances of employee misconduct, particularly focusing on insubordination and related violations. This form, which should be filled out by a department manager, requires clear details such as the employee's name, ID number, department, and the specific nature of the violation, which may include refusing assigned work, inappropriate behavior, or violations of company policies. Users must document the incident thoroughly in designated fields, including the date, individuals involved, and specifics of what occurred, ensuring clarity and accuracy. Moreover, employee comments, as well as signatures from involved parties, are required to validate the process. This form serves a critical function in maintaining workplace order and accountability within organizations and can be used by various professionals, including attorneys, partners, owners, associates, paralegals, and legal assistants, to support HR practices and compliance with employment laws. It assists in documenting disciplinary actions taken at different levels, from verbal warnings to potential discharge, ensuring that all procedures are duly noted and provide a basis for any future actions.

Every disciplinary action form should have these basic section in this general order: Employee information (e.g., name, date notice given, supervisor, etc.). Violation type (e.g., language, rudeness, disobedience, etc.). Violation details (e.g., date, time, and place violation occurred).

Follow Business Correspondence Rules. Write the letter on company letterhead. ... State the Facts. An insubordination letter is not an opportunity to vent your grievances at an employee who has become a nuisance or a liability. ... Provide Examples of Behavior. ... Note Consequences.

Describe the incidences of insubordination and also mention the dates and the names of the parties involved. Avoid being dramatic, but describe the misconduct clearly that would help anyone reading the letter understand what actually happened and why the employee's misconduct merits a reprimand.

Specific consequences of insubordination often differ depending on the severity of the offense, company policies and applicable employment laws. Potential consequences may include verbal or written warnings, suspension, demotion, loss of privileges, termination of employment or legal actions in some more extreme cases.
